John 11:28

“And when she had so said, she went her way, and called Mary her sister secretly, saying, The Master is come, and calleth for thee.”

People's Bible Notes for John 11:28


Joh 11:28-30 Called Mary her sister secretly. The Lord had evidently directed her to do this, for she said, "The Master calleth for thee". At once, with a promptitude that shows her joy, Mary arose and hastened out of the town to the place where the Lord still tarried.
